With the premium boat MS Amore or MS Azimut you sail from island to island in the South Dalmatian archipelago. Along the way you will experience
secluded coves - perfect for a cooling dip in the Mediterranean directly from the boat. By bike you will explore the winding routes of the beautiful islands close to the mainland coast. Along the way, you will pass the most beautiful beach in Croatia: Zlatni Rat, "the golden cape", located on the southern coast of the island of Brač. You' will explore the UNESCO cities of Dubrovnik and Trogir, and cycle through the vast forests of the island of Mljet and if you're a red wine lover, you should enjoy a glass of Dingač from the Pelješac peninsula. In other words, you can expect a lot of culture and nature on this bike cruise through southern Dalmatia.
Your boat will follow you like a hotel from island to island, and the crew will show you secluded coves where you can swim. Cycling is usually on the winding paths along the coast before you return to your ship in the evening, and if you feel like skipping a day of cycling, just enjoy the day on board.
Cycling requires at least a basic level of fitness, which you should have achieved by occasional or daily cycling. The routes take you easily up to an altitude of about 100-300 metres above sea level. You will cycle between 20 and 40 km each day through hilly and mountainous terrain. You will have plenty of time to complete each ride. Sometimes there will be steeper inclines, but of course it is okay to walk the bike over these if necessary. The roads are mostly paved and there is little traffic outside of holiday periods. It is your choice whether to cycle on your own with maps and information material, or to join the cycling guide who rides with you.
In Croatia, everyone under 18 is required to wear a bicycle helmet - but we strongly recommend that everyone, regardless of age, does so.
On this trip in the South Dalmatian archipelago of Croatia, MS Amore has room for 40 passengers.
This motor yacht is from 2011 and therefore relatively new. On board there are 19 cabins, offered in different versions. Most are double cabins with either two single beds, or one queen-size bed ("frensh bed" approx. 140 cm wide). A few cabins are sold as single rooms and triple cabins.
MS Amore has a fantastic sundeck of 250m2. Here you can enjoy the Croatian sun to the full, as well as the views of land and sea, which alone are worth the experience.
Cabins on MS Amore
MS Amore has a total of 19 exterior cabins, each about 14 m². The main deck is divided into two, locally referred to as the middle and upper decks. On the upper deck there are six double cabins - four with 2x single beds and two with queensized double bed (140cm wide). On the middle deck there are also four double cabins with 2x single beds and one with queensized bed (140cm wide). The last eight cabins are located below deck. Here are four with single beds, two with queensized beds (140cm) and two are arranged as triple cabins with a queensized bed plus a single bed. The portholes in the cabins below deck are the only ones that can be opened. All other cabins do not have windows that can be opened.
All 19 cabins have en suite bathrooms with shower and toilet and individually controlled air conditioning.
Please note: The allocation of cabins takes place upon arrival. It is possible to pre-book a cabin on either the lower deck, the main deck or the upper deck, but it is not possible to define a specific cabin.
Common areas on MS Amore
One of the highlights of the MS Amore is the 250 m² sun deck. Here you can stay comfortably on one of the sun beds or garden chairs and enjoy the warm temperatures. If you need to cool down after sunbathing, you can take a shower directly on the bathing platform, and should you need a break from the heat, there is also an air-conditioned lounge on the sundeck.
The sun deck has space for bikes and 25 sun loungers, 20 garden chairs and tables/benches for 20 people. With only 40 passengers, socializing is easily accessible, with the sundeck as a gathering place.

See more pictures »There are a few departures in the season where MS Azimut is the ship of the trip.
The ship is of the same premium standard as MS Amore.
It is a motor sailer built in 2016. In the years 2019 - 2022 the ship is slightly remodelled. This included optimising both the ship's saloon and the cabin bathrooms. In addition, better air conditioning was installed and a bathing platform was added at the stern of the ship.
You can enjoy a large sun deck of approx. 90 m² with sun loungers and seating. On the rear area of the upper deck there are more sun loungers, tables and chairs and even a whirlpool. The ship's saloon can accommodate all 40 guests and there is additional seating on the main deck.
The cabins on MS Azimut
MS Azimut has a total of 18 exterior cabins, each measuring approximately 14 square metres. All cabins have their own shower/toilet and individually regulated air-conditioning.
On the lower deck there are:
6 double cabins with queen-sized double bed (140cm wide)
2 triple cabins with queen-sized double bed (140cm wide) and single bed above.
On the main deck there are:
3 double cabins with 2 single beds,
1 double cabin with queen-size double bed (140cm wide).
On the upper deck there are:
2 double cabins with 2 single beds,
2 double cabins with queen-sized double bed (140cm wide)
2 triple cabins with 1 queen-size double bed (140cm wide) and 1 single bed above.
The portholes on the lower deck can be opened. On the main- and upper deck, no windows can be opened, but the cabin door itself can.
Common areas on MS Azimut
In the stern of the upper deck there is a 50m² common area with sun loungers, sun sail and a whirlpool. In addition, there is a 90m² sun deck with sun loungers and seating. At the stern of the ship you will find the bathing platform and inside you will find the large air-conditioned communal lounge.

You will embark on board MS Amore or MS Azimut between 13.00 and 14.00 in Trogir. While the boat starts sailing, a welcome drink and a small snack will be served, while the boat's bike-guide will welcome you and brief you on the first bike ride. You will sail to the island of Brac, where the first bike ride that afternoon will take you from Supetar to Pucisca.
Distance: approx. 25km
Altitude +/- 640 m
Just after breakfast, the boat will sail for the island of Korcula. This is known as the Black Island because of its pine forests. From the port of Racisce you cycle via Kneza and Zrnovska Banja to Korcula. Via Pupnat and Kneza you cycle back to the boat which then takes you back to Korcula for the night.
Distance: approx. 35 km
Altitude +/- 680.
This morning is enjoyed on board the boat as it heads towards the island of Mljet. Here you cycle from Sobra, through the island's forests via Prozura to Saplunara. After lunch and a break for a refreshing swim, you cycle back to Sobra. From here you sail on to the Elafiti island of Sipan, where you dock for the night.
Distance: approx. 30 km
Altitude +/- 910 m
Today you start with a short bike tour of the island of Sipan, from Sipanska Luka to Sudurad and back. Once back on the boat, you will sail to Dubrovnik, arriving around lunchtime. After lunch on board, there is the opportunity for a guided tour of the city. After the tour, there will be plenty of time to get to know the UNESCO city better.
Distance: approx. 10 km
Altitude: +/- 200m.
In the morning you head for Prapratno on the Peljesac peninsula. Here you will hop on your bike and cycle to the 5.5km long wall connecting Ston and Mali Ston. Via Dubrava and Zuljana you cycle on to Trstenik, where the boat will be waiting for you before you sail to Kucište for the night.
Distance: approx. 35 km
Altitude +/- 700m
The day starts with a boat trip to the island of Hvar. From here you cycle through fields of lavender and wine to Stari Grad, the oldest settlement on the island. In Stari Grad, lunch is served on board the boat, after which you continue the cycling tour. This time a round trip via Vrboska and Jelsa before returning to the port of Stari Grad, where you will also spend the night.
Distance: approx. 40 km
Altitude: +/- 860m
You sail the two-hour long trip from Stari Grad to Stomorska on the island of Solta. Along the way, just enjoy the beautiful scenery that passes by.
On Solta you cycle from Stomorska to Maslinica through beautiful, unspoilt villages. After lunch there is time for a last swim before the boat takes you back to Trogir.
Distance: approx. 20 km
Altitude +/- 300m
After breakfast, check-out is until 9.00 and then individual departure.

Flights
Depending on your place of departure you can fly to Split airport, which is only 5 km from Trogir, where MS Amore starts and ends her trip.
There are direct flights from many european airports to Split.
The trip from the airport to the boat is easily taken by taxi. It is also possible to take a local bus.
Please note that embarkation on MS Amore is between 14:00 and 16:00, the earlier the better.
Drive yourself
If you choose to drive yourself to Trogir, there is supervised parking near the boat dock for about 70-80€ per week.
Space must be reserved in advance and paid locally (remember the local currency is Croatian Kuna).

Half board is included on this tour.
On days where either lunch or dinner is not included, there will be easily accessible dining options close to either your cycling route, or the port towns.
Special meal requests, such as dietary or vegetarian, can be accommodated by arrangement - and should be advised when booking the trip.
All drinks must be paid for locally.
Due to the altitude profile, we do not recommend this tour for children. The tour is best suited from 14 years and up.
If you wish to bring a younger child, please have a chat with us about the possibilities, and abilities of your child.
Further important information about your trip by bike and boat:
Tips for the boat crew are not included in the price.
It is customary to tip the crew of the boat at the end of the trip. The level is about 5€ from each participant. per day. On a trip like this of 7 days duration, about 35€ per person would be appropriate (remember that the Croatian currency is Kuna).
There will typically be an envelope in the cabin for this purpose, or information will be provided at the end of the trip.
